By Brad Friedman on 3/28/2005 3:42pm PT  

The National General Counsel for Bush/Cheney '04 Inc., Mark F. (Thor) Hearne, II gave testimony on behalf of his three-day old "American Center for Voting Rights" (ACVR) last Monday at a U.S. Congressional Hearing. He represented the only "Voting Rights" group at the hearing --- called by Republican Bob Ney (R-FL), Chairman of the U.S. House Administration Committee --- purportedly investigating the '04 Ohio Presidential Election mess.

Hearne didn't bother to mention that he worked for Bush/Cheney '04 as their top attorney in his testimony. We're not positive, but fairly certain that no high-level Kerry/Edwards employees were invited to testify, whether they represented a phony "non-partisan" group like the ACVR or not.

Despite the claims of tax-exempt non-partisan status by this Talon News-like outta-nowhere GOP front group, the two known ring-leaders (that we've been able to identify so far) of this phony "Voters Rights" organization masquerading as if they are not-an-insult-to-real-Voters-Rights-groups-everwhere, are both currently veryactive partisans.

Jim Dyke, the group's press spokesman and website administrative and technical contact who, as well as being the 2004 Communications Director for the Republican National Committee, is also a current Fox News GOP Analyst according to Joseph Cannon (though he mentioned to us that, so far, he was unable to confirm that information). He does, however, offer a fine analysis of just one of the likely true missions for this group, and why they have suddenly appeared. And for the record, Cannon made note of this nascient and suspicious ACVR popping up the day before we did!

Describes Himself as 'Advocate of Voter Rights' But Not as Bush/Cheney '04 General Counsel!
By Brad Friedman on 3/24/2005 4:58pm PT  

Monday's testimony to a U.S. House Committee by Mark F. (Thor) Hearne, the leader of the American Center for Voting Rights (ACVR) --- who also happens to be the National Counsel for Bush/Cheney '04, Inc. --- has just been added to the website of the "non-partisan", tax-exempt, one-week old "Voting Rights" group.

In his testimony, Hearne failed to mention to the U.S. House members, either his connection to Bush/Cheney or his long roots in the Republican party going back to the Reagan Administration. The testimony was given last Monday to the U.S. House Administration Committee at hearings held on the Ohio Election problems. The hearings to which Hearne was invited were held just 3 business days after the ACVR suddenly appeared for the first time on the Internet...or anywhere else that we've been able to find. More on that here.

In Hearne's testimony, as seen via the page posted today on the ACVR's website [UPDATE 2007: the testimony may now be found here in the Interenet archives, since ACVR has deleted their site], he describes himself as a "a longtime advocate of voter rights and an attorney experience in election law". No mention of his long-term pedigree as a high-level GOP operative...

Testimony of Mark F. (Thor) Hearne, II
Committee On Administration
Columbus, Ohio --- April 21, 2005 [ed note: Misdated on the website]
Chairman Ney, Members of the House Administration Committee, thank you for inviting me to testify today.

My name is Thor Hearne. I am a principle in the law firm of Lathrop & Gage and a longtime advocate of voter rights and an attorney experienced in election law. I was appointed a member of the Missouri HAVA advisory committee advising the Missouri Secretary of State on Missouri's implementation of HAVA and suggesting appropriate amendments to Missouri election law.

Today I am here in my capacity as counsel to the American Center for Voting Rights. The ACVR is a non-partisan watchdog ? voting rights legal defense and education center committed to defending the rights of voters and working to increase public confidence in the fairness of the outcome of elections. I am joined in this endeavor by the almost a dozen Ohio lawyers from several of this states' prestigious law firms that have submitted a report detailing concerns that have come to our attention in connection with the Ohio 2004 general election...

    By Brad Friedman on 3/23/2005 5:43pm PT  

    Today we attempted to get some more information about the "American Center for Voting Rights" (ACVR), a group who suddenly appeared on the Internet last Thursday. On Monday, they gave testimony to U.S. Congressman Bob Ney's (R-OH) House Administrative Committee during hearings held in Columbus, OH on the 2004 Election mess in the state.

    (Please see this previous BRAD BLOG article for the emerging background on this supposedly "non-partisan" tax-exempt organization which was the only such "Voting Rights" group invited to give testimony at the hearings. And, oh yes, every single name attached to this group so far seems to also be attached to Bush/Cheney '04 Inc. and/or the Republican National Committee and/or the Ohio Republican party.)

    Mark F. (Thor) Hearne, II --- the National General Counsel for Bush/Cheney '04 Inc. --- gave testimony for the group and is listed on the U.S. House Administrative Committee website as simply "National Counsel, American Center for Voting Rights". No mention of his current high-level connections to Bush/Cheney and his long history of working with other powerful Republican officials all the way back to his time working for the Reagan Administration.

    We called him this morning to see if we could ask him a few questions about the ACVR, his involvement as their apparent-organizer and his role as lead contributor for the 31-Page report [PDF] on the Ohio Election produced by the ACVR in time for Monday's hearings.

    Hearne's response, "Not right now...Send me some information about who you're involved with and I'll give you a call back."

    We persisted nonetheless, and asked if he could describe any of the "voter education and outreach" programs which the "About Us" page at the ACVR website describes as one of their activities. Or if he could tell us about any of the "symposiums and conferences" the group claims to be sponsoring as also mentioned on the site.

    His response, "We certainly anticipate those. You keep an eye on our website."

    We pressed on...

    BRAD BLOG: How is it that you guys were invited to testify for a U.S. House Committee hearing after just forming so recently?

    MARK F. (THOR) HEARNE, II: You'd have to ask the [House] committee...

    BB: But to be invited as the only such organization so quickly after being formed? How did that happen?

    HEARNE: I couldn't tell you. We're out here doing what we're doing and we accepted the offer.

    He was, indeed, rather terse in the answers to our attempted questions, and so we wondered why he didn't wish to be more forthcoming about his "non-partisan" group.

    "Sounds to me like your coming from the Left," he told us.

    We informed him that --- though we think didn't think any of our questions were particularly partisan or Left-like --- he might well say that we are indeed coming from the Left. Nonetheless, we consider free and fair elections to be a non-partisan issue. As his website claims to be a non-partisan organization, we figured he wouldn't mind answering some questions about it.

    Mr. Hearne told us to "Email me some information on who you are and I'll get back to you."

    We have done so and look forward to his call and a report here on his answers to some of our many concerns.

    Next we tried a call to Jim Dyke who is listed as the "contact" in a press release issued Monday by AVCR.

    Dyke, we have subsequently learned, also happened to have been the Communications Director for the Republican National Committee during the 2004 Election.

    Perhaps he would be more open with us about this nascient group and their seemingly newfound concern for "Voting Rights" in America. Indeed, Dyke was much more willing than was Hearne to speak at length with us...

    By Brad Friedman on 3/23/2005 3:33pm PT  

    If you had any questions about what sort of fellow Ohio Secretary of State (and Co-Chair for Ohio's Bush/Cheney '04 campaign) J. Kenneth Blackwell is give a quick listen to this 4-minute audio report on yesterday's hearings from Ohio Public Radio featuring some of the heated exchanges between His Arrogance Mr. Blackwell, and some the questioners.

    (See our previous report explaining this rare appearance by Blackwell who has, until now, snubbed all such hearings at which he was called to testify and refused to answer a single question about the 2004 Election which he was designated to oversee as "fair and impartial" arbiter.)

    Additionally, we received this report from a congressional staffer who was inside the hearing room in Columbus on Monday:

    In a complete abrogation of protocol, he refused to shake the hands of a fellow witness, Ohio Rep. Stephanie Tubbs Jones.

    When Miss Tubbs Jones called him out on it, Blackwell explained that he wanted to see "how she acted" before he was willing to shake her hands. As if she was the one responsible for the voting rip-off and long lines in Ohio.

    Because of his stonewalling during the question period, Tubbs Jones was forced to declare that Blackwell would have to "haul butt" if he wouldn't respond to his questions.

    When called to task concerning the absurd paper weight requirements, he left the explanation for a staffer, and than left and made an obnoxious salute gesture toward the Democrats on the panel – Ranking Member Millender McDonald and Tubbs Jones.
